基于大模型的接口参数标准化方法、装置、设备及介质与流程
- 国知局
- 2024-11-21 12:10:10
本申请涉及数据转换,尤其涉及一种基于大模型的接口参数标准化方法、装置、设备及介质。
背景技术:
1、随着业务的发展和需求的变化,往往需要将更多的系统和模块集成在一起,而在实际应用中,不同系统或模块可能由不同的开发团队或供应商开发,其可能使用不同的技术栈和设计理念,导致接口参数定义不统一。这种不一致性给系统的集成和维护带来了很大的挑战,增加了开发和维护成本,降低了系统的稳定性和可扩展性。目前为了解决此类问题,通常采用手动映射的方法将接口参数映射为标准参数,但手动映射接口参数不仅效率低下,而且可能导致接口调用失败或数据错误,无法满足快速集成和迭代的需求。
2、因此,如何准确高效地进行接口参数映射,是目前亟需解决的一个问题。
技术实现思路
1、本申请的主要目的在于提供一种基于大模型的接口参数标准化方法、装置、设备及介质,旨在解决如何准确高效地进行接口参数映射的技术问题。
2、为实现上述目的,本申请提出一种基于大模型的接口参数标准化方法,应用于接口参数转换系统,所述接口参数转换系统配置有大模型,所述的方法包括:
3、将提示词输入至所述大模型,通过所述大模型获取与所述提示词中待转换接口参数对应的原始参数名称,并通过所述大模型将所述原始参数名称映射为标准参数名称;
4、基于所述标准参数名称将所述待转换接口参数转换为标准接口参数,并输出所述标准接口参数。
5、在一实施例中,所述通过所述大模型将所述原始参数名称映射为标准参数名称的步骤包括:
6、通过所述大模型分析所述提示词,以使所述大模型学习原始参数名称和标准参数名称之间的参数映射关系;
7、通过所述大模型基于所述参数映射关系映射所述原始参数名称,得到标准参数名称。
8、在一实施例中,所述提示词还包括转换任务描述、映射规则、映射字典、转换示例和对话历史,所述通过所述大模型分析所述提示词,以使所述大模型学习原始参数名称和标准参数名称之间的参数映射关系的步骤包括:
9、通过所述大模型解析所述转换任务描述和所述映射规则,并通过所述大模型基于所述转换任务描述、所述映射规则、所述映射字典和所述对话历史学习所述转换示例,以使所述大模型学习原始参数名称和标准参数名称之间的参数映射关系。
10、在一实施例中,所述基于所述标准参数名称将所述待转换接口参数转换为标准接口参数,并输出所述标准接口参数的步骤包括:
11、基于所述标准参数名称替换所述原始参数名称,得到所述标准接口参数;
12、将所述标准接口参数进行封装,并输出封装后的所述标准接口参数。
13、在一实施例中,所述接口参数转换系统还配置有字典构造单元,所述提示词至少包括映射字典,所述的基于大模型的接口参数标准化方法还包括:
14、通过所述字典构造单元获取历史转换数据,并通过所述字典构造单元基于所述历史转换数据,生成各原始参数名称和各标准参数名称之间的参数映射关系合集;
15、将所述参数映射关系合集转换为映射字典,其中,所述映射字典的键为所述各标准参数名称,所述映射字典的值为所述各原始接口名称。
16、在一实施例中,所述通过所述字典构造单元基于所述历史转换数据,生成各原始参数名称和各标准参数名称之间的参数映射关系合集的步骤包括:
17、通过所述字典构造单元提取所述历史转换数据中的所述各原始参数名称和所述各标准参数名称,并通过所述大模型学习所述各原始参数名称和所述各标准参数名称之间的转换关系,以生成所述各原始参数名称和各标准参数名称之间的参数映射关系合集。
18、在一实施例中,所述提示词还包括待转换枚举值,所述基于大模型的接口参数标准化方法还包括:
19、通过所述大模型获取与所述待转换枚举值对应的原始枚举值名称,并通过所述大模型将所述原始枚举值名称映射为标准枚举值名称,其中,所述提示词中的映射字典还记载有各原始枚举值名称和各标准枚举值名称之间的枚举值映射关系;
20、基于所述标准枚举值名称将所述待转换枚举值转换为标准枚举值,并输出所述标准枚举值。
21、此外,为实现上述目的,本申请还提出一种基于大模型的接口参数标准化装置,应用于接口参数转换系统,所述接口参数转换系统配置有大模型,所述基于大模型的接口参数标准化装置包括:
22、映射模块,用于将提示词输入至所述大模型,通过所述大模型获取与所述提示词中待转换接口参数对应的原始参数名称,并通过所述大模型将所述原始参数名称映射为标准参数名称;
23、输出模块,用于基于所述标准参数名称将所述待转换接口参数转换为标准接口参数,并输出所述标准接口参数。
24、此外,为实现上述目的,本申请还提出一种电子设备,所述设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序配置为实现如上文所述的基于大模型的接口参数标准化方法的步骤。
25、此外,为实现上述目的,本申请还提出一种存储介质,所述存储介质为计算机可读存储介质,所述存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上文所述的基于大模型的接口参数标准化方法的步骤。
26、此外,为实现上述目的,本申请还提供一种计算机程序产品,所述计算机程序产品包括计算机程序,所述计算机程序被处理器执行时实现如上文所述的基于大模型的接口参数标准化方法的步骤。
27、本申请提出的一个或多个技术方案,至少具有以下技术效果:
28、本申请首先将提示词输入至所述大模型,通过所述大模型获取与所述提示词中待转换接口参数对应的原始参数名称,并通过所述大模型将所述原始参数名称映射为标准参数名称,以通过大模型自动处理提供了参数映射和转换的必要信息的提示词,并通过大模型的映射实现了接口参数名称的标准化,以减少了人工干预,提高了接口参数标准化的自动化程度;基于所述标准参数名称将所述待转换接口参数转换为标准接口参数,并输出所述标准接口参数,以保证接口调用接收到的参数所遵循的命名规则是一致的,有助于避免因为命名规则不一致导致的参数混淆和数据错误问题。
29、综上所述,本申请通过运用大模型基于接收到的提示词,将待转换接口参数自动转换为标准接口参数,避免了手动映射过程中效率低下且转换准确率不高的问题,实现了准确高效地进行接口参数映射的效果。
技术特征:1.一种基于大模型的接口参数标准化方法,其特征在于,应用于接口参数转换系统,所述接口参数转换系统配置有大模型,所述基于大模型的接口参数标准化方法包括:
2.如权利要求1所述的基于大模型的接口参数标准化方法,其特征在于,所述通过所述大模型将所述原始参数名称映射为标准参数名称的步骤包括:
3.如权利要求2所述的基于大模型的接口参数标准化方法,其特征在于,所述提示词还包括转换任务描述、映射规则、映射字典、转换示例和对话历史,所述通过所述大模型分析所述提示词,以使所述大模型学习原始参数名称和标准参数名称之间的参数映射关系的步骤包括:
4.如权利要求1所述的基于大模型的接口参数标准化方法,其特征在于,所述基于所述标准参数名称将所述待转换接口参数转换为标准接口参数,并输出所述标准接口参数的步骤包括:
5.如权利要求1所述的基于大模型的接口参数标准化方法,其特征在于,所述接口参数转换系统还配置有字典构造单元,所述提示词至少包括映射字典,所述的基于大模型的接口参数标准化方法还包括:
6.如权利要求5所述的基于大模型的接口参数标准化方法,其特征在于,所述通过所述字典构造单元基于所述历史转换数据,生成各原始参数名称和各标准参数名称之间的参数映射关系合集的步骤包括:
7.如权利要求1所述的基于大模型的接口参数标准化方法,其特征在于,所述提示词还包括待转换枚举值,所述基于大模型的接口参数标准化方法还包括:
8.一种基于大模型的接口参数标准化装置,其特征在于,应用于接口参数转换系统,所述接口参数转换系统配置有大模型,所述基于大模型的接口参数标准化装置包括:
9.一种电子设备,其特征在于,所述设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序配置为实现如权利要求1至7中任一项所述的基于大模型的接口参数标准化方法的步骤。
10.一种存储介质,其特征在于,所述存储介质为计算机可读存储介质,所述存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至7中任一项所述的基于大模型的接口参数标准化方法的步骤。
技术总结本申请公开了一种基于大模型的接口参数标准化方法、装置、设备及介质,涉及数据转换技术领域,该方法应用于接口参数转换系统,所述接口参数转换系统配置有大模型,包括:将提示词输入至所述大模型,通过所述大模型获取与所述提示词中待转换接口参数对应的原始参数名称,并通过所述大模型将所述原始参数名称映射为标准参数名称;基于所述标准参数名称将所述待转换接口参数转换为标准接口参数,并输出所述标准接口参数。本申请通过运用大模型基于接收到的提示词,将待转换接口参数自动转换为标准接口参数,避免了手动映射过程中效率低下且转换准确率不高的问题,实现了准确高效地进行接口参数映射的效果。技术研发人员:陆志鹏,韩光,李嘉宁,郑曦,郭祎萍,范国浩,刘彬彬,马博原,屈鹏琦受保护的技术使用者:中电数据产业集团有限公司技术研发日:技术公布日:2024/11/18本文地址:https://www.jishuxx.com/zhuanli/20241120/334658.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。
下一篇
返回列表